Scenario-based identification of multiple deficiencies

medium

Instead of asking about a single element, NEET might present a plant exhibiting symptoms of two different deficiencies (e.g., older leaves yellowing, and young leaves showing interveinal chlorosis). This tests the student's ability to apply knowledge of both mobility and specific symptoms simultaneously. It requires a more analytical approach than simple recall and can serve as a good differentiator for higher-scoring students.

Application of critical concentration concept

low

While 'critical concentration' is a core concept, it's less frequently tested directly in NEET MCQs. However, a question might frame a scenario where nutrient levels are just below the critical concentration, leading to initial symptoms. This would test the understanding of the threshold nature of deficiency. It could be a conceptual question asking about the implications of falling below this threshold rather than a numerical one.

Distinguishing deficiency from toxicity symptoms

medium

Both deficiency and toxicity can lead to similar-looking symptoms like chlorosis or necrosis, but their underlying causes are opposite. A question might present a symptom and ask if it's due to deficiency or toxicity, or ask to differentiate between them for a specific element (e.g., Manganese toxicity also causes brown spots). This tests a deeper understanding beyond just identifying deficiency symptoms.

Role of specific elements in enzyme activation/inhibition and its link to symptoms

low

While NEET primarily focuses on visible symptoms, a more challenging question could link a deficiency symptom to the impaired function of a specific enzyme that the element activates or is a component of. For example, linking Molybdenum deficiency to 'whiptail' due to its role in nitrate reductase. This requires integrating knowledge of mineral nutrition with biochemistry.
